O'Grady says today (12:49am post):
"Well it looks like those waiting to take delivery of a 17-inch PowerBook G4 will have to wait a little longer. When I asked a contact at Apple about the suggestions that production 17" PBs are beginning to hit the streets I received this response:
We have not yet started production so there is no way anyone is receiving one. As we announced at Macworld we are still targeting to start production the very end of February.
If that is the case then one could only reasonable expect the first units to arrive from Taiwan on or around the first week of March. This information seems to contradict the rumors that some Apple stores have begun to receive their display models. Some Apple staff have been hitting the demo circuit with a fleet of 17s that must be pre-production units."
I'm not posting this to say anything about "delays," that has become a hotly-contested issue! But it might explain all the "display-only" 17"ers appearing at Apple Stores around the country. Perhaps some stores are letting customers try out these "pre-production units?"
